Which GPU makes more sense?

RTX 3060 Ti is the stronger Blender rendering pick here, and both cards have the same VRAM capacity.

Blender render speed

RTX 3060 Ti leads by 4.3% in the Renderjuice Blender benchmark model (2,996 vs 2,873). For render-time-first decisions, that is the card to prioritize.

VRAM and scene headroom

Both cards have 8 GB of VRAM, so the decision is less about scene capacity and more about render speed, architecture, power draw, and price.

Power and cooling

RTX 5050 is the lower-power option at 130 W TDP, compared with 200 W for RTX 3060 Ti. If render speed is close, that can make RTX 5050 easier to cool and run quietly.

Upgrade decision

RTX 5050 is newer, but RTX 3060 Ti still leads this Blender benchmark comparison. That makes the older card worth considering when used pricing or VRAM capacity is favorable.
